The Power of Real-Time Data Collection
Data is the foundation of effective decision-making — but manual collection is slow, error-prone, and reactive.
With IoT-enabled sensors, operators now collect continuous, real-time readings from key system components:
-
Flow meters
-
Pressure transducers
-
Turbidity, chlorine, and pH monitors
-
Equipment diagnostics (e.g., pump RPMs, tank levels)
Benefits of Automated Data Collection:
-
Accuracy: Reduce transcription errors and standardize data inputs
-
Efficiency: Eliminate hours of manual readings and reports
-
Visibility: Access dashboards and trendlines that reveal system patterns
-
Compliance: Auto-generate logs and alerts that simplify audits
Automation: Bridging Data and Action
Automation is where things get actionable. By integrating tools like SCADA or smart logic controllers, water systems can now respond in real time without operator input.
Examples:
-
A drop in chlorine residual? The system increases dosing automatically.
-
A pump overpressure event? Alarms trigger and flow reroutes to prevent failure.
-
Overnight demand drops? Pumps throttle down to save energy.
Core Automation Features:
-
Remote Monitoring & Control (desktop or mobile)
-
Real-Time Alerts for anomalies
-
Automatic Scheduling for pumps, backwashes, or chemical feeds
-
Cost Reduction through lower labor and optimized energy use
Automation doesn’t replace operators — it amplifies them.
AI: The Next Evolution in Water Intelligence
Artificial Intelligence takes water automation to a new level by adding context, memory, and learning.
Instead of following static rules, AI systems learn from historical data and live inputs to predict, adapt, and optimize system behavior.
Top Use Cases for AI in Water Operations:
Predictive Maintenance
AI analyzes pump motor vibrations, flow rate changes, or backwash cycles to forecast equipment failure before it happens — reducing emergency repairs and downtime.
Water Quality Forecasting
Using environmental sensors and historical data, AI can predict when an algal bloom or turbidity spike is likely, enabling preemptive action.
Energy & Chemical Optimization
AI can schedule pump cycles based on energy pricing, flow demand, and dosing rates — saving thousands in annual O&M costs.
Challenges to Consider
As powerful as these technologies are, implementation must be strategic.
Key Considerations:
-
Upfront Costs: Hardware, software, and integration can require capital investment
-
Training Needs: Operators may need upskilling in data interpretation and system management
-
Cybersecurity: Connected systems require strong firewalls, authentication, and access protocols
Success lies in pairing tech with human insight — not replacing one with the other.
